Find your future with us.The Boeing Company is seeking a 2nd Shift787 Manufacturing Workplace Coach Manager (Level K) to support the 787 Airplane Program at the Airport Campus in North Charleston, South Carolina. We seek strong leadership, interpersonal and coaching skills to further enable our business units to embrace and advance our One BPS culture, tools, and key performance indicators. In Manufacturing, we embrace daily a First Pass Quality approach, and our leaders must be committed to the success of every team member. Position Responsibilities: Manage, develop, and motivate a team of Manufacturing Workplace Coaches (WPCs) across multiple manufacturing business units (MBUs) to serve and help mechanics - new and experienced - perform with confidence and effectiveness Own and execute a governance strategy for Structured On-Job Training (SOJT) across multiple MBUsDevelop and maintain multiple Skill Enhancement Centers (SECs) that simulate the production system and provide a safe, risk-free environment for hands-on training through Guided Skills Practices (GSPs); SECs are expected to contain several Guided Skills Practices (GSPs) that are an identical replica of the airplane Ensure WPCs are driving meaningful improvements & tightly aligned to the business' highest priorities, including rate and flow enablers, top defect drivers, and baseline jobsBuild and maintain strong partnerships across manufacturing and support organizations, especially Production Engineering, to keep the team focused on the most critical production system needsCommunicate a clear vision for the organization and current status effectively to executive leadershipChampion a safety and quality mindset while modeling Boeing Values and BehaviorsBoeing First-Line Leader Assessment: To be considered for this position, you will be required to complete an assessment as part of the selection process. Failure to complete the assessment will remove you from consideration.Basic Qualifications (Required Skills/Experience):Candidates must have at least one (1) year of experience in a leadership role (team leader, temp manager, large scale cross functional project/program management, or formal manager experience) OR have completed the Boeing internal course 'Exploring Leadership'3+ years of experience advising & influencing managers or non-managers to meet schedules or resolve technical/operational problems3+ years of experience in aerospace manufacturing operations or supportPreferred Qualifications (Desired Skills/Experience): 3+ years of experience in leadership development, coaching, and training for mechanics3+ years of experience leading Boeing Problem Solving Model (or similar) and Root Cause Corrective Action (RCCA) activities3+ years of leadership or management experience in a manufacturing / production environment3+ years of experience in collaborative problem solving, building relationships & professional written and verbal communicationsExperience with 787 Airplane Program operations (or related experience)Conflict of Interest:Successful candidates for this job must satisfy the Company's Conflict of Interest (COI) assessment process.Shift:This is a 2nd shift position, but occasionally requires supporting WPC's on alternate shifts as needed.Drug Free Workplace:Boeing is a Drug Free Workplace where post offer applicants and employees are subject to testing for marijuana, cocaine, opioids, amphetamines, PCP, and alcohol when criteria is met as outlined in our policies.Travel: Position may require up to 10% travel.Pay & Benefits:At Boeing, we strive to deliver a Total Rewards package that will attract, engage and retain the top talent.
